For Devils head coach Sheldon Keefe, it was a bittersweet return to Scotiabank Arena, his first visit since getting axed by the Leafs last spring. A game he likely desperately wanted to win.
Sheldon Keefe jokes about owing the Leafs a point
Keefe was in good humor following the defeat. According to Sportsnet's Luke Fox, he was even able to joke about falling to his old team, a real testament to just how strong a relationship he continues to have with the Maple Leafs organization.
«Disappointed we don't leave with two points here, but, you know, I probably owe the Leafs an extra point.»
His return was somewhat spoiled when William Nylander scored the overtime winner to seal the Leafs' victory. Keefe could still find a way to have a bit of a laugh about the tough loss in his postgame interview.
